Description
The Navy Multiband Terminal (NMT) is the fourth-generation maritime military satellite communications (SATCOM) terminal, providing seamless and assured connectivity to the Global Information Grid (GIG) via the Advanced Extremely High Frequency (AEHF) and Wideband Global SATCOM (WGS) systems. In this SBIR, Caliola Engineering, LLC (“Caliola”) will develop an innovative Satellite Communications Antenna Pointing for Positioning (SCAPP) solution that fuses a time series of precise angular pointing vectors recorded in the NMT Data Recording Element (DRE) with speed and heading estimates from the NMT Operator Interface Software (OIS) to produce a time series of estimates of the position of the vessel. Associated with each position estimate will be geolocation error ellipses for configurable confidence levels. The probabilistic vessel position estimates produced by SCAPP could be fused with the outputs of other sensors – e.g., inertial navigation systems (INS) – to provide precise Position, Navigation, & Timing (PNT) in the absence of GPS. In particular, SCAPP outputs will be compatible with the Non-GPS Aided PNT for Surface Ships (NoGAPSS) federated filter that will reside in GPS-based PNT Service (GPNTS) systems.
